Actress Edie Falco is sharing the bond she has with her beloved pooch in a new film featuring a string of celebrity pet owners. The former "The Sopranos" star will host the premiere of "My Dog: An Unconditional Love Story" at the Guild Hall in the Hamptons, New York on August 23.
The movie explores the relationship between people and their pets through candid interviews with celebrity dog lovers, including actors Richard Belzer and Richard Gere, actress Glenn Close and fashion designer Isaac Mizrahi. The film also features one of the last big screen appearances by late actress Lynn Redgrave, whose pooch Viola has lived with Redgrave's daughter, Annabel, since the star's May death.
The documentary is directed and co-produced by playwright Mark St. Germain.
